ruiner — meaning in English

French → English · translate English → French instead

English meaning

  • ruin verb To destroy, spoil, or severely damage something so it no longer works or pleases.
  • wreck noun The remains of a vehicle, ship, or structure that has been destroyed or badly damaged.

Senses

ruiner is used for these senses in English:

  • banjax (UK, originally, Irish, slang) To ruin or destroy.
  • blow to kingdom come (transitive, idiomatic) To totally destroy (something); to annihilate or wipe out (something).
  • ruin (transitive) To cause the fiscal ruin of; to bankrupt or drive out of business.
  • ruin To reveal the ending of (a story); to spoil.
  • wreck (transitive) To destroy violently; to cause severe damage to something, to a point where it no longer works, or is useless.
  • wreck (transitive) To involve in a wreck; hence, to cause to suffer ruin; to balk of success, and bring disaster on.
